What a Pasadena party bus rental actually costs
We publish our rates. Pasadena bookings run $150–$450/hr depending on bus size, with most groups landing on the 20-passenger mid-size. Here's the per-person math on a standard 4-hour booking:
| Bus size | Hourly rate | 4-hr total | Per person (full bus)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 12-passenger | $150–$200/hr | ~$700 | ~$58 |
| 20-passenger ★ most popular | $250/hr | ~$1,000 | ~$50 |
| 30-passenger | $325/hr | ~$1,300 | ~$43 |
| 40-passenger | $400–$450/hr | ~$1,700 | ~$42 |
For a Rose Bowl crew, that math beats the alternative every time — no $50 stadium parking, no surge-priced rideshares fighting post-game traffic, and nobody stuck sober. A 20-person bus is ~$50 a head, BYOB, with a rolling tailgate and a gate drop. See the full LA pricing breakdown →
Rates run higher on Rose Bowl game days, the Rose Parade/NYE, weddings, and prom/grad season, and may include a fuel and gratuity line — always shown up front, never sprung at pickup.
